What’s in a day?
Day 8. Rest day in Austin In the daily stats column “AIS” (ass in seat) refers to actual time riding the bike. Doesn’t include snack stops, photo stops, lunch, etc. Elevation climb is overall amount of climbing in the total ride. Typically we are waking up about 6:30am.
